Description: 
At 322 PM EDT, Doppler radar was tracking a strong thunderstorm near Willow Street, moving east at 40 mph. HAZARD...Wind gusts up to 50 mph. SOURCE...Radar indicated. IMPACT...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around unsecured objects. Locations impacted include... Quarryville, Gap, Wakefield, Smithville, Christiana, Georgetown, Kirkwood, Little Britain, Refton, and Buck.
Instruction: 
If outdoors, consider seeking shelter inside a building. Very heavy rainfall is also occurring with this storm and may lead to localized flooding. Do not drive your vehicle through flooded roadways. Frequent cloud to ground lightning is occurring with this storm. Lightning can strike 10 miles away from a thunderstorm. Seek a safe shelter inside a building or vehicle. A Severe Thunderstorm Watch remains in effect until 900 PM EDT for south central Pennsylvania.
